Electric Water Heater Repair in San Jose, CA
Electric water heater repair services address issues related to malfunctioning or failing electric water heating units commonly found in residential properties. These projects typically involve diagnosing problems such as no hot water, inconsistent temperature, strange noises, or leaks, and then performing repairs to restore proper operation. Homeowners often seek this service to resolve sudden breakdowns, improve energy efficiency, or ensure their hot water supply remains reliable for daily needs. Before requesting repair services, property owners usually want to understand the nature of the problem, the age and condition of the unit, and whether repairs are a cost-effective solution compared to replacement.
The scope of electric water heater repair can include fixing faulty thermostats, replacing heating elements, addressing electrical wiring issues, or repairing corrosion and leaks. Property owners should be prepared to provide details about the symptoms they are experiencing and the age of the unit. Understanding the make and model of the water heater can also help in assessing repair options. Clear communication about the problem can assist technicians in diagnosing the issue efficiently and recommending the most appropriate course of action to restore hot water service effectively.

Common Electric Water Heater Repair Jobs
Electric Water Heater Repair - restores hot water supply by fixing faulty heating elements or thermostats.
Electric Water Heater Replacement - installs new units to improve efficiency and reliability.
Thermostat Troubleshooting - addresses temperature control issues to prevent overheating or insufficient heating.
Leak Detection and Repair - stops water leaks caused by corrosion, damaged valves, or faulty fittings.
Component Replacement - replaces worn or broken parts such as heating elements, sensors, or wiring.
Electrical System Inspection - ensures safe operation by checking wiring connections and circuit integrity.
Electric Water Heater Repair Questions
What are common signs of a water heater needing repair? Signs include inconsistent hot water, strange noises, leaks, or a lack of hot water during use.
Can a water heater be repaired if it’s not heating properly? Yes, many issues causing inadequate heating can be diagnosed and fixed without replacing the unit.
Is it possible to prevent water heater problems? Regular maintenance and inspections can help identify issues early and extend the lifespan of the unit.
What types of water heater repairs are typically performed? Repairs often involve replacing thermostats, heating elements, valves, or fixing leaks and sediment buildup.
